Dill Veggie Dip

Creamy dill veggie dip is a quick and flavorful crowd-pleaser, perfect for pairing with fresh veggies.

Dried herbs are stirred into sour cream and mayo for an easy homemade dip ready in minutes.

Ingredients

  • Sour Cream: Full-fat sour cream will give a richer texture, while low-fat or fat-free versions may be thinner and slightly less flavorful. For a healthier dip, swap for plain Greek yogurt.
  • Mayonnaise
  • Dried Herbs: The star of the show! Dried herbs are easy because you can always have them on hand. To swap for fresh, use 1½ teaspoons of fresh dill and 1 teaspoon of parsley.
  • Onion Powder
  • Salt: Helps the flavors of the dip pop. Add more or less to your preference.

If the dip is too thick, you can thin it slightly with 1-2 teaspoons of milk or buttermilk.

How to Make Dill Dip

  1. Add all ingredients to a bowl and stir until well combined.
  2. Refrigerate for 1 hour to let the flavors meld.

Serve with your favorite fresh veggies like cucumbers, carrots, peppers, and broccoli. It’s also delicious served as a chip dip or with crackers!

Store the dip in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 3-4 days, stirring before serving.

Dill Veggie Dip

Creamy dill veggie dip is a quick and flavorful dip, perfect for pairing with fresh veggies or crackers.
Course Appetizer
Cuisine American
Prep Time 5 minutes
Refrigeration Time 1 hour
Total Time 1 hour 5 minutes
Servings 16 Servings
Calories 125kcal
Author Ayla O’Neill

Equipment

  • mixing bowls

Ingredients

  • 1 cup sour cream
  • 1 cup mayonnaise
  • tablespoons dried dill
  • 1 tablespoon dried parsley
  • 1 teaspoon onion powder
  • ½ teaspoon salt adjust to taste

Instructions

  • In a medium-sized mixing bowl, stir together all ingredients until well combined.
  • Cover the bowl with plastic wrap and refrigerate for at least 1 hour.
